so if we say science doesn’t begin with faith, it begins with assumptions so is there a difference between a faith and an assumption the main difference is that assumption is a scientifically acceptable word and faith is a scientifically unacceptable word and the principle essentially is the same that when I assume something that means at least as a working hypothesis or as a provisional way of functioning I accept that it may be like this and later on it may prove to be right it may prove to be wrong but it is not that’s why I was not talking about theories this theory may be right this theory may be wrong and when a scientist is experimenting with a particular theory they have an assumption that it may be right and I will test it out that’s fine so in that sense that provisional nature of the assumption is applicable when we are considering specific theories but when we consider the foundational laws of nature then that is not just a functional assumption it’s a foundational assumption without that science itself will not function so when scientists went deep into the study of matter and they found that Newton’s laws of motion were not explaining the behavior of matter either at the microscopic level or at the macroscopic level then they did not ok they said ok maybe this Newton’s theory doesn’t work so we could say that Newton’s theory was a functional assumption which they were ready to shelve now but still they started looking for some other theory which could explain and that searching for some other theory requires the assumption at a particular foundational level that some theory will explain that there is some law that nature operates ok this law is not right but there must be some other law that we will operate and that’s how they came up with quantum physics at the microscopic level they came up with relativity at the macroscopic level that’s why Einstein said that the most incomprehensible thing about the universe is that it is comprehensible the most incomprehensible thing about the universe is that it is comprehensible that means if we consider that the whole of existence is a product of unguided natural processes say an explosion or whatever if the whole of the world is a product of unguided natural processes then my brain is a product of unguided natural processes the world out there is a product of unguided natural processes so why is it that the world out there has an order orderliness to it, a structure to it why is it that my mind internally my brain internally has the capacity to perceive order and why is there a correlation between my brain’s capacity to perceive order and nature to exhibit that order so this is a three level three level correlation it’s like say I go to some foreign land and then I find that some paper comes over there and that paper has some script on it and I suddenly say I know this language I never learned that language before but suddenly I can read this language and then it makes sense you are lost over here, take left, go straight go away, you will come back to a safe place so now if such a thing has happened to me I just find myself in a foreign place and I get a paper with some script written on it so there are three things over there that there is a paper with some script written on it that I have a brain which can read that which can read that script and that script contains a message that I can understand it could be containing many things it may be somebody writing something in that language which has no relevance to me so this triple level of correlation is something which is foundational assumption in science that nature has an order that human brain or human mind whatever you want to say has a capacity to pursue order and the order in nature is of a kind which a human brain can pursue it’s like another example is that I find myself in a strange place and there is a door with a lock and I look around I find a key over there I look at the key and the key fits over there so first of all why is that building with a door with a lock over there why is the key over there and how is this key fitting the lock so all these three are very foundationally required for me to enter into that door similarly for science to be able to comprehend anything these three are required and that’s why I say that the most incomprehensible thing about the universe is that it is comprehensible so functional assumptions may be quantitative hypothesis but the foundational assumption that the universe is comprehensible is an article of faith
